What type of air distribution system is often utilized in commercial buildings to enhance energy efficiency?

Explanation:
The variable air volume system is often utilized in commercial buildings to enhance energy efficiency due to its ability to adjust the airflow based on the current heating or cooling needs of different spaces. This system modulates the amount of conditioned air supplied to various areas, allowing for more precise temperature control and reducing energy consumption. By varying the volume of air instead of operating at a constant volume, this system can respond more dynamically to changes in occupancy or usage patterns throughout the day. This flexibility leads to lower energy usage since the system does not waste energy on unnecessary heating or cooling when conditions do not require it. Overall, the ability to optimize airflow based on actual demand is a key factor in improving energy efficiency in commercial buildings.

What’s a Variable Air Volume System Anyway?

The VAV system is designed to adjust the amount of air supplied to different spaces based on their heating or cooling needs at any given moment. Why Choose VAV Over Other Systems?

You might be thinking, "Isn’t there an easier option?" Let’s break down why a variable air volume system triumphs over its counterparts:

  • Energy Efficiency: VAV systems only utilize energy as needed. Unlike constant volume systems that pump the same amount of air regardless of demand, VAV systems adjust airflow, reducing wasted energy.

  • Enhanced Comfort: Maintaining precise temperature control across various spaces can be challenging. With a VAV system, different areas can be controlled independently, making the environment more comfortable for everyone.

  • Flexibility: Commercial spaces are dynamic. People come in and out or have varying activities throughout the day. The VAV system responds accordingly, meaning no more heating or cooling empty rooms!

The Nuts and Bolts

Getting into the nitty-gritty, the VAV system uses dampers to regulate airflow. These dampers close or open according to the commands of a central management system which monitors temperature and occupancy. This responsiveness is something constant volume systems just can’t compete with. When Is a VAV System the Right Choice?

While it sounds fantastic, the VAV system isn’t a one-size-fits-all solution. Best suited for larger commercial spaces with fluctuating occupancy, think of office buildings, shopping malls, or hospitals. For smaller spaces, it might be overkill.
